Determining whether your home needs a water heater installation involves a few key considerations. Firstly, if you don't have a water heater installed in your property, it's an obvious indication that installation is required. Additionally, if you're moving into a new home or undertaking a significant renovation project, it's crucial to evaluate the water heating system's capacity and condition. Choose the right location

Select an appropriate location for the water heater installation. Ensure it complies with local building codes and provides sufficient space for proper ventilation, maintenance, and easy access to plumbing connections.

Follow safety precautions

When working with gas-powered water heaters, be cautious and follow safety guidelines. Make sure all gas connections are tight and leak-free, and consider consulting a professional if you're not experienced in working with gas lines.

Test for leaks

After installing the water heater and connecting the plumbing, check for any leaks. Slowly turn on the water supply and inspect all connections for drips or moisture. If any leaks are detected, promptly address them by tightening connections or using appropriate sealants.
